WebThe Berrys (John Henry, Beacon, Samuel) The Berry family lives far from the Logans, in a town called Smellings Creek. Because they live so far out, they don't come around often, but they do make it in to the local church sometimes (1.32). John Henry and Beacon are brutally murdered by the Wallaces as a punishment for allegedly flirting with a ... Taylor about a Black family living in Mississippi during the Depression-era. The story is narrated by 9-year-old Cassie Logan, who tells the story about her family, their land, and the struggle for survival in the face of racism.
